Therefore what is during the a credit report?

Your ount of individual economic study on your credit file. It contains information regarding most of the mortgage you take in new last half dozen ages – if or not your continuously pay timely, just how much you borrowed from, what your credit limit is found on for every membership and you will an email list out of registered credit grantors who’ve utilized the document.

All the membership boasts a great notation complete with a letter and you can a number. The brand new letter “R” refers to a great rotating financial obligation, given that page “I” signifies an instalment membership. The numbers go from 0 (also not used to speed) so you can nine (bad personal debt or set to own collection https://www.cashadvancecompass.com/personal-loans-va/windsor otherwise bankruptcy.) Getting a revolving account, an R1 get is the notation to have. Which means you pay your expenses within this thirty days, or “due to the fact concurred.”
